The Moon is partially eclipsed at 0149 a.m. EST (0649 GMT) during a lunar eclipse in Great Falls, Virginia, outside Washington December 21, 2010. During the eclipse, Earth lined up directly between the Sun and the Moon, casting Earths shadow over the Moon. REUTERS/Hyungwon Kang (UNITED STATES - Tags: ENVIRONMENT SCI TECH IMAGES OF THE DAY)
